{{tag>pose}} ===== Di Mario Knot ===== Also: Double Buddasana. A progression the [[Human knot]] [[frontbend]]. Instead of crossing the ankles behind the neck, the calves cross further down the back. The arms are wrapped backwards around the the calves to keep them in place, as there is insufficient bracing to do so otherwise. This pose is frequently assisted, either by a coach, or with a [[equipment:stretch strap]] to allow the performer to pull their legs into position from a more manageable angle. It is possible for the feet to continue to be pushed further down the back, achieving sufficient bracing, but this requires a [[concept/overextension]] of the knees that most people are incapable of, even with training.
